3. Setup Instructions

Follow these steps to set up your VENTION Wireless HDMI system:

  1. Connect the Receiver (RX): Plug the HDMI Receiver (RX) into an available HDMI input port on your display device (e.g., HDTV, projector, monitor). Connect the provided USB-C power cable to the RX unit and a power source (e.g., USB wall adapter, TV USB port). The RX unit requires external power to function.
  2. Adjust Input Source: On your display device, select the correct HDMI input source that the RX unit is connected to. This will allow the display to receive the signal from the wireless system.
  3. Connect the Transmitter (TX): Plug the HDMI Transmitter (TX) into the HDMI output port of your source device (e.g., PC, laptop, gaming console, camera). The TX unit can often draw power directly from the HDMI port. If the TX unit does not power on or the signal is unstable, connect a USB-C power cable to the TX unit and a power source.
Diagram showing connection steps for HDMI Receiver, adjusting input, and HDMI Transmitter

Image: Step-by-step connection guide for the VENTION Wireless HDMI system, illustrating how to connect the RX to the display, select the input, and connect the TX to the source device.

The system is designed for plug-and-play operation, requiring no driver installation, Bluetooth pairing, or Wi-Fi configuration.

4.3 Multiple Transmitters to One Receiver

The VENTION Wireless HDMI system allows for multiple transmitters to connect to a single receiver. This feature is particularly useful in conference settings, enabling quick switching between different presenters or source devices. Up to 8 pairs of kits can be used in the same location without interference.

Illustration of a conference setup with one receiver and multiple transmitters

Image: A conference room setup demonstrating one receiver connected to a display, receiving signals from multiple laptops equipped with transmitters, allowing for seamless switching.

4.4 Wireless Transmission Range

The system utilizes advanced 5GHz transmission technology for stable and efficient signal transfer. It offers a transmission range of up to 50 meters (164 feet) in environments with minimal interference. Please note that obstacles such as walls or floors can reduce the effective range to approximately 10 meters (32 feet).

6.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your VENTION Wireless HDMI system, refer to the following common problems and solutions:

ProblemPossible Cause / Solution
No signal or black screen
  • Ensure both TX and RX units are properly powered. The RX unit must be powered via USB-C.
  • Verify that the HDMI cables are securely connected to both the source and display devices.
  • Check if the display device is set to the correct HDMI input source.
  • Try connecting the TX unit to an external USB-C power source if it's not receiving enough power from the HDMI port.
  • Reduce the distance between the TX and RX units, or remove any obstructions.
Intermittent signal or flickering screen
  • Interference from other wireless devices (e.g., Wi-Fi routers, cordless phones). Try to move the units away from such devices.
  • Distance too great or too many obstructions. Shorten the distance or clear the line of sight.
  • Ensure both TX and RX units have stable power supply.
No audio
  • Check audio settings on your source device and display.
  • Ensure the HDMI connection supports audio transmission.
Cannot stream copyrighted content (e.g., Netflix, Prime Video, YouTube)
  • Some streaming services implement HDCP (High-bandwidth Digital Content Protection) which may prevent wireless transmission of copyrighted material. This is a limitation of HDCP, not a defect of the device.
Device gets hot quickly
  • It is normal for electronic devices to generate some heat during operation. Ensure adequate ventilation around the units. If overheating causes performance issues, discontinue use and contact support.

7. Specifications

FeatureDetail
Model NumberADCL0
Product Dimensions1.26 x 4.13 x 0.49 inches
Item Weight6.4 ounces
Wireless Frequency5GHz
Transmission RangeUp to 50m (164ft) in open environments; approx. 10m (32ft) through walls/floors
Video Resolution SupportUp to 1920x1080@60Hz (1080P@60Hz)
CompatibilityHD TVs, Projectors, Laptops, Cameras, Cable Boxes, PCs, DVDs, Gaming Consoles, Tablets
Connector TypeHDMI
Power InputUSB-C (RX required, TX optional)
Multiple TX to RXSupports up to 8 transmitters to one receiver
